How to see it

HIP 1988 has a visual magnitude of about 7.71: it usually needs binoculars or a small telescope, especially from light-polluted sites.

Sky position

Equatorial coordinates for HIP 1988: right ascension 0h 25m 10s, declination +64° 38′ 19″ (J2000), in the region of the Cassiopeia constellation (IAU figure Cas).
